12 Examples of Stunning Hypocrisy from Tea Party Republicans In One Short Month
It's only been a month since the new Tea Party lawmakers took office, but the entirely predictable results of their ascension are already coming in. The Republican Party's newest class of “mavericks” have again stormed into office intent on proving their theory that government is inherently evil by screwing up everything in sight.

Before we embark on our tour of the Tea Party politicians' early moves – and those of the party they were supposed to be “taking back” -- let's recall exactly what they promised: they were relentlessly focused on economic issues – and, we were told, would eschew the kind of social issues that had long marked Republican politics in the era of the Religious Right. They would bring greater transparency and accountability to government. They promised to be good fiscal stewards, respond to the wishes of the people and, above all else, they swore up and down to obey the letter of the Constitution.

Let's see how they did in the early going.

I Hate Government Health Care. Also: Where Is My Government Health Care?

The hypocrisy began before the new class of pols was sworn in. When it was reported that “a conservative Maryland physician elected to Congress on an anti-Obamacare platform surprised fellow freshmen at an orientation session by demanding to know why his government-subsidized health care plan takes a month to kick in,” it raised eyebrows.

When Rep. Ron Paul, R-Texas, the titular inspiration for the Tea Party movement, was asked if he thought it was hypocritical for members of Congress to accept government-subsidized and regulated health plans, he replied simply, “ould be.”
